Two simple tariffs
Kia Charge offers you the choice of charging tariffs based on your travel needs.

Kia Charge Easy
Perfect if you only occasionally use public car charging points. It gives you the freedom to access most UK charging stations — with no monthly subscription fee.

Kia Charge Plus
Made for you if you use electric public car charging stations on a regular basis. It gives you a 15% discount compared to the Easy tariff on networks other than bp pulse, Pod Point and IONITY. It also means you won't have to pay a session fee in the UK.

IONITY — Power subscription
IONITY’s network of ultra-fast 350kW electric car charging stations is dotted along the UK and Europe’s major motorways.
Kia Charge already gives you seamless access to this network but with our £11.25-per-month one-year bolt-on subscription, you pay only £0.25 per kWh in the UK or €0.29 in most other European countries.

bp pulse — bp pulse subscription
Kia Charge already gives you access to the bp pulse network but with our optional bp pulse subscription and for just £7.85 per month, you benefit from significantly reduced kWh prices across Kia Charge’s largest individual charging network.
How long will it take to charge an electric car at a public station?
Public car charging stations vary in type, and this means that they offer different charging speeds.

AC Charging
Best used for long parking stays like overnight on-street charging.

DC Charging
Perfect for charging quickly while en-route to a destination.
AC charging time refers to Niro EV on 22kW charger
DC charging time refers to EV6 (10 - 80% capacity) on 350kW charger.

Where can I find Electric car charging points? Where can I find Electric car charging points?
With Kia Charge, you have access to the UK’s largest collection of charging networks and to more than 360,000 charge points across Europe. Kia Charge lets you locate EV charging stations using a familiar map tool and clever filters. It also gives you up-to-the-minute information about availability and pricing before you navigate to your chosen station. If your Kia comes with Kia Connect, you can also find electric car charging points through your car's points of interest directory. This lets you check the station’s characteristics and availability before you navigate to it.
How much does it cost to charge an Electric car at a charging point? How much does it cost to charge an Electric car at a charging point?
Prices vary between network operators but thanks to Kia Charge, you’re able to consult prices prior to charging. You also have a range of tariffs to suit your profile. Light users of public charging can opt for our ‘Easy’ tariff with no monthly instalment or minimum spend. More frequent users of public charging can choose our ‘Plus’ tariff, which grants 15% discount and no session fee in all networks other than bp pulse, Pod Point and Ionity. Kia Charge users can also choose from two optional subscriptions: bp pulse and Ionity subscriptions, which offer the best possible value when charging within these two networks. How do I pay for public charging? How do I pay for public charging?
It’s now really easy to charge on the go. With Kia Charge, you never have to pay every time you charge. Start and stop a charging session and just drive away: all your billing is consolidated in a monthly, itemised invoice that gives you complete oversight of your activity and spending.
